Hello: I have been photographing nature and the natural world for the past 35 years. Being born and raised in Northern Minnesota, I was introduced to nature at a very early age. Some of my first memories are of walking with my dad or grandfather in the woods. Countless hours as a child and youth were spent hunting, fishing, and exploring in the vast wilderness I called home. I always preferred shooting with my camera over with a gun and started to develop my style and my “eye” early on. Photography has always been more than an interest or hobby to me.
